Nur nicht vorhandene Daten kopieren - xcopy

Deine Frage passt nicht in die anderen Bereiche, dann stelle sie hier.
Antworten

Du kannst eine Option auswählen

 
 
Ergebnis anzeigen

Benutzeravatar
Lem0th
Senior
Senior
Beiträge: 405
Registriert: 18.08.2016, 23:15
Gender:

Nur nicht vorhandene Daten kopieren - xcopy

Beitrag von Lem0th » 17.01.2017, 21:45

Hi,

Aufgrund dessen, dass ich mir mein altes Benutzerprofil zerschossen habe, wollte ich mein altes Nutzerprofil komplett sichern. Habe es so zu erst gemacht:

Code: Alles auswählen

xcopy c:\users\tygan c:\users\lem0th
Soweit lief das auch alles problemlos, allerdings lief mir der Speicher auf der Festplatte voll, dementsprechend hat sich das kopieren beendet.

Nun bin ich auf eine .bat gestoßen, allerdings ist diese eher zum kopieren von einzelnen Dateitypen geeignet, daher wollte ich hier mal fragen inwieweit man die Modifizieren kann, dass sie erkennt welche Daten bereits im Zielverzeichnis vorhanden sind und diese nicht aus der Quelle kopieren tut.

Die .bat poste ich hier mal mit:

Code: Alles auswählen

@echo off
setlocal enabledelayedexpansion

set quelle=c:\users\lemoth\
set ziel=c:\users\lem0th
set maske=*.tif

echo. > %temp%\schonda.txt
for /f "tokens=*" %%d in ('dir "%ziel%\%maske%" /b /s') do (
  set zieldatei=%%d
  set quelldatei=!zieldatei:%ziel%\=%quelle%\!
  echo !quelldatei! >> %temp%\schonda.txt
)
xcopy "%quelle%\%maske%" "%ziel%" /s /i /c /k /e /exclude:%temp%\schonda.txt
del %temp%\schonda.txt
Besitze leider kaum kenntnisse darüber.

Edit: Robocopy habe ich meine Zweifel mit, wegen dem hier:
/purge
Deletes destination files and directories that no longer exist in the source.
/mir
Mirrors a directory tree (equivalent to /e plus /purge)

Tante Google

Nur nicht vorhandene Daten kopieren - xcopy

Beitrag von Tante Google » 17.01.2017, 21:45


Benutzeravatar
hib
Senior
Senior
Beiträge: 414
Registriert: 15.05.2016, 08:18
Gender:

Re: Nur nicht vorhandene Daten kopieren - xcopy

Beitrag von hib » 18.01.2017, 04:43

wieso verwendest Du nicht einfach den Windowsexplorer?
Wenn Du den Inhalt eines Verzeichnises selektierst und in ein Verzeichnis kopierst das schon Daten enthaelt, werden erst alle nichtvorhandenen Daten kopiert und anschliesend kannst Du Dir aussuchen ob:
Diese Datei ersetzen?
Alle Abbrechen...
Gruss
Hib

__________________________________________________

Schreibfehler sind beabsichtigt und dienen der Volksbelustigung.

Lesen gefaehrdet die Dummheit!!! :D

Gast

Re: Nur nicht vorhandene Daten kopieren - xcopy

Beitrag von Gast » 18.01.2017, 09:44

Oder TotalCommander, der ist a) 2-fenstrig und kann b) diese beiden Fenster, also auch 2 Verzeichnisse/Ordner vergleichen [shift/F2], da wird auf einen Blick angezeigt, welche Dateien bereits vorhanden, welche neuer sind, einmal die Markierung umgekehrt, rüberkopiert, fertig. Schnell + effektiv.

Benutzeravatar
Lem0th
Senior
Senior
Beiträge: 405
Registriert: 18.08.2016, 23:15
Gender:

Re: Nur nicht vorhandene Daten kopieren - xcopy

Beitrag von Lem0th » 18.01.2017, 12:20

Der Windows Explorer kopiert ja alles über und fragt erst zum Schluss ob man das ersetzen will. Außerdem dauert mir das mit dem Explorer zu lange, da er wie gesagt alles kopiert und bei 50 GB das ein wenig lange braucht.

Totalcommander kann ich mir mal an gucken.

Benutzeravatar
hib
Senior
Senior
Beiträge: 414
Registriert: 15.05.2016, 08:18
Gender:

Re: Nur nicht vorhandene Daten kopieren - xcopy

Beitrag von hib » 18.01.2017, 13:11

Das ist nicht richtig, der Explorer ueberprueft, was es kopieren kann und kopiert nur die nicht vorhandenen Dateien und dann, wenn das erledigt ist, kannst Du entscheiden ob und was Du ueberschreiben willst. Probiers doch einfach mit 3-4 Dateien aus.
Gruss
Hib

__________________________________________________

Schreibfehler sind beabsichtigt und dienen der Volksbelustigung.

Lesen gefaehrdet die Dummheit!!! :D

Benutzeravatar
Lem0th
Senior
Senior
Beiträge: 405
Registriert: 18.08.2016, 23:15
Gender:

Re: Nur nicht vorhandene Daten kopieren - xcopy

Beitrag von Lem0th » 18.01.2017, 15:22

Meine Erfahrungen sind zumindest so, dass der Windows-Explorer beim Kopieren der Daten immer total lahmt und xcopy bzw. robocopy immer recht flott waren. Zeigte der Explorer ~15 Minuten an, waren xcopy oder robocopy schon längst fertig.

Antworten